The humidity in air today shot up to 92 per cent, causing discomfort to Delhiites while on the lower side it was recorded at 51 per cent, MeT office said.
"The skies will be partly cloudy. Very light rains or thundershowers could occur in some parts of the city after midnight till morning. There will be shallow fog or mist early in the morning," a MeT official said.
According to MeT office, the minimum temperature was recorded at 18.6 degrees Celsius, a notch above normal while the maximum settled at 32.2 degrees C, also a notch above the normal.
Yesterday, the day temperature had settled at 33.1 degrees C and minimum was registered at 19 degrees C.
